Strict Liability And State-Of-The-Art Evidence In Illinois, James Christensen

Northern Illinois University Law Review

This comment discusses Illinois' treatment of state-of-the-art evidence as a defense to a strict liability claim. The article argues that Illinois should disallow the defense in the area of unknowable risk for the same reasons that Illinois disallows the defense in undiscoverable risk.

Server Vs. Driver Liability: A Suggested Change To Reduce Drinking And Driving, Grant Pearson

Northern Illinois University Law Review

This article explores the two major approaches to liquor server liability currently being used in the various jurisdictions across the country. The article assesses the strengths and weaknesses of the alternative approaches and concludes that certain adjustments in the dram shop laws, coupled with additions to the insurance requirements and vehicle inspection program, will help to make drivers aware of the costs of drinking and driving, thereby reducing the incidence of drunk driving.
